Winter Warm-Up: Textures, Layers, and Comfort
As the temperatures drop, your home should feel like a sanctuary, warm, welcoming, and layered with comfort. Scatter cushions are your go-to for this season.
➤ What to look for:
-
Materials: Think chunky knits, faux fur, mohair, and velvet. These rich textures add warmth and visual depth to your living areas.
-
Colours: Earth tones like terracotta, olive, mustard, and rust create a cocoon-like atmosphere. Pair them with neutral base tones for a grounded palette.
➤ How to style:
-
Layer different-sized scatter cushions on your couch or bed to create that “sink-in” look.
-
Add wall art with darker frames or warm-toned abstract prints. African-inspired artwork with natural elements like wood, clay, or woven textures adds seasonal richness.
Pro Tip: Swap lighter summer wall hangings for deeper, textured pieces like handwoven wall baskets, wooden shields, or beaded artwork to instantly “winterise” your space.
Summer Refresh: Light, Bright & Breezy
Summer calls for a light touch, both in fabric weight and colour choice. Your goal is to make rooms feel more spacious, breathable, and energised.
➤ What to look for:
-
Materials: Linen, cotton, and mudcloth are lightweight and breathable, perfect for the heat.
-
Colours: Whites, sky blue, peach, and sage green keep the energy fresh and open.
➤ How to style:
-
Mix and match scatter cushions with playful prints or coastal-inspired patterns. Try pairing geometric or tribal designs with plain pastels for contrast.
-
Rotate in wall art with nature themes, open landscapes, or minimalistic line art. Lightweight palm leaf or rattan pieces can also bring in that relaxed holiday energy.
☀️ Keep it airy: Replace heavy frames with light canvas art or unframed textiles to make walls feel less “heavy.”
The Power of Pairing: Scatter Cushions & Wall Art Working Together
When styled intentionally, scatter cushions and wall art work in harmony to tie a room together. They echo colour themes, balance visual weight, and can even establish the tone of the room, from minimalist elegance to eclectic Afro-modern.
Match tip:
-
Choose one “lead colour” from your wall art and echo it through your cushions.
-
Use wall art to set the scene, whether it’s cultural, abstract, or scenic, and let cushions carry the tone across the room.
For example, a bold African mask or Rwandan sun basket paired with neutral-toned scatter cushions in mudcloth brings both drama and cohesion.

Seasonal Decor: Your 3-Step Swap Formula
-
Declutter first
– Strip back to your core furniture and assess the space. -
Swap & Style
– Switch cushion covers and wall pieces for seasonal styles. -
Layer with Intention
– Use textures and prints strategically to elevate or soften the vibe.
Bonus: Don’t forget to update shelf decor and small tabletop accents. A candle, a vase, or a woven bowl in the right tone finishes the look.
